Ajax complete €14m signing of Chuba Akpom from Middlesbrough

Ajax have officially announced the signing of Chuba Akpom from Middlesbrough. The Dutch giants will pay an initial fee of €12.3m, which can rise to €14.3m through variables. The 27-year-old striker has signed a contract valid until June 2028. 

Chuba Akpom scored 28 goals in 38 Championship appearances for Middlesbrough last season, making him the league’s top scorer. After an outstanding campaign, several sides including Ligue 1 club Lens have shown serious interest in the former Arsenal, Hull City and PAOK striker. Ajax made their move and have won the race for the London-born player.

Ajax only had one striker in their squad prior to adding Akpom to the selection. Brian Brobbey (21) was the only man available in that position, but now Ajax have extra fire power. Akpom will wear the number 10 shirt this season after becoming Ajax’s sixth summer signing. This could turn out to be brilliant business for the 36-time Eredivisie champions, who are looking to win more silverware this season.
